1. Why did the people who wrote the Constitution create different branches of government?​

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 12-05-2021

Answer:

The Founding Fathers, the framers of the U.S. Constitution, wanted to form a government that did not allow one person to have too much control.

Explanation:

With this in mind, wrote the Constitution to provide for separation of powers, or three separate branches of government.
